What’s happened recently
- Major recalls in the U.S. involved brands like Power XL (Empower Brands) with dual-basket models due to a burn hazard from a faulty basket connector. Hundreds of thousands of units were affected and consumers were advised to stop using the units and pursue refunds.[1][2]
- Best Buy expanded recalls of Insignia-branded air fryers and air fryer ovens, citing overheating, melting handles, and shattered glass doors as hazards. About 187,400 units in the U.S. and roughly 99,900 in Canada were impacted, with refunds or store credits offered through the recall process.[3]
- Other recall activity included broader reviews and listings of brands like Insignia, Cosori, Magic Chef, and more, with millions of units affected in aggregate across multiple recalls, driven by fire/burn and laceration hazards. A comprehensive media review summarized the scale across Insignia, Cosori, and related brands.[4][8]
How to check if your air fryer is recalled
- Identify the exact brand and model number printed on the unit or in the user manual.
- Compare with recall notices on official sites (U.S. CPSC, Health Canada) or the retailer’s recall page where the unit was purchased.
- If your model is listed, stop using it and follow the manufacturer or retailer’s instructions for refund, replacement, or disposal.
What to do if yours is recalled
- Do not use a recalled unit that’s identified in the recall.
- Contact the manufacturer or retailer for instructions on refunds, replacements, or disposal.
- If you can’t find a model in recall lists, preserve the unit until you confirm status and consider unplugging and keeping it away from children and pets.
